CCTV fundamentals

What is CCTV?

Closed-Circuit Television (CCTV) is a type of surveillance system that uses cameras to capture and transmit video signals to a specific place, such as a monitor or recording device.

Key Components

1. Cameras: Capture video footage of a specific area.
2. Lenses: Determine the camera's field of view and focus.
3. DVR/NVR: Digital Video Recorder (DVR) or Network Video Recorder (NVR) stores and manages recorded footage.
4. Monitors: Display live or recorded footage.
5. Cabling: Connects cameras to DVR/NVR or network.

Types of CCTV Cameras:

1. Bullet Cameras: Weather-resistant, suitable for outdoor use.
2. Dome Cameras: Discreet, vandal-resistant, and suitable for indoor use.
3. PTZ Cameras: Pan, Tilt, and Zoom for flexible monitoring.

CCTV Applications:

1. Security and Surveillance
2. Monitoring and Observation
3. Evidence Collection

Benefits:

1. Deterrent Effect: Visible cameras can deter crime.
2. Real-time Monitoring: Enables immediate response to incidents.
3. Evidence Collection: Provides valuable footage for investigations.
